Freigeben über


ScriptReferenceBase.NotifyScriptLoaded Eigenschaft

Definition

Achtung

NotifyScriptLoaded is no longer required in script references.

Ruft einen Wert ab, der angibt, ob das ScriptResourceHandler-Objekt automatisch Code am Ende der ECMAScript-Datei (JavaScript) zum Aufrufen der Client-NotifyScriptLoaded-Methode der Sys.Application-Klasse anfügt, oder legt ihn fest.

public:
 property bool NotifyScriptLoaded { bool get(); void set(bool value); };
public bool NotifyScriptLoaded { get; set; }
[System.Obsolete("NotifyScriptLoaded is no longer required in script references.")]
public bool NotifyScriptLoaded { get; set; }
member this.NotifyScriptLoaded : bool with get, set
[<System.Obsolete("NotifyScriptLoaded is no longer required in script references.")>]
member this.NotifyScriptLoaded : bool with get, set
Public Property NotifyScriptLoaded As Boolean

Eigenschaftswert

Boolean

true, wenn die Sys.Application.notifyScriptLoaded-Methode automatisch am Ende einer JavaScript-Datei aufgerufen wird, oder false, wenn Benutzercode die Sys.Application.notifyScriptLoaded-Methode aufruft, die bereits in der JavaScript-Datei vorhanden ist. Der Standardwert ist true.

Attribute

Hinweise

Legen Sie die -Eigenschaft auf fest, wenn Sie auf eine Skriptdatei in einer Assembly verweisen und die Skriptdatei bereits Code zum Aufrufen von NotifyScriptLoaded false Sys.Application.notifyScriptLoaded enthält. Ein Fehler wird ausgelöst, wenn die Sys.Application.notifyScriptLoaded-Methode aus einer Skriptdatei mehr als einmal aufgerufen wird.

Wenn Sie auf eine eigenständige Skriptdatei verweisen, die nicht in eine Assembly eingebettet ist, müssen Sie Code am Ende der Skriptdatei zum Aufrufen der Sys.Application.notifyScriptLoaded-Methode verwenden. Das folgende Beispiel zeigt den Code, der am Ende der Skriptdatei enthalten sein soll.

if(typeof(Sys) !== "undefined) Sys.Application.notifyScriptLoaded();  

Gilt für